Job description

Job Details Job Location: Fremont 0NK54 - Fremont, CA Position Type: Full Time Salary Range: $26.00 - $30.00 Job Category: Facilities Description

Summary:

Perform routine preventive maintenance and occasional troubleshooting, to ensure that production equipment continue run smoothly and operate efficiently. Perform electrical, hydraulic, mechanical and pneumatic repairs. Install and/or replace equipment. Apply and follow TPS/Lean principles, and perform all functions with a strong emphasis on internal customer satisfaction and support to manufacturing.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following:

  • Perform regular preventive maintenance on production equipment and tooling.
  • Troubleshoot issues and provide unscheduled repairs of production equipment.
  • On-call support for emergency repairs essential for continued production.
  • Adhere to safety procedures for all plant activities relating to the operation of production equipment.
  • Assist in the monitoring and guidance of maintenance and repair work performed by outside contractors and service providers.
  • Attend necessary training seminars and/or hands-on training on an as needed basis, to increase knowledge and understanding of equipment repair and maintenance.
  • Initiate, complete, and properly document service requests and work orders using the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S).
  • Collaborate with Operations, Quality and Engineering on continuous improvement projects.
  • Perform other assignments as required and determined by the needs of the business.
  • Performs typical maintenance tasks to support the production floor and the entire facility.
  • Provides emergency/unscheduled repairs of production equipment during production and performs scheduled maintenance repairs of production equipment during machine service.
  • Reads and interprets equipment manuals and work orders to perform required maintenance and service.
  • Diagnoses problems, replaces or repairs parts, test and make adjustments.
  • Performs a variety of plumbing maintenance and carpentry functions.
  • Uses a variety of hand and power tools, electric meters and material handling equipment in performing duties.
  • Performs prescribed preventative maintenance on machinery and the building or grounds as required.
Qualifications

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required/preferred.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

Job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

  • Must have a high level of mechanical aptitude.
  • Works well with others and proactively contributes to group objectives.
  • Ability to read and interpret specifications, blueprints, schematics, work instructions and equipment manuals.
  • Ability to maintain regular, predictable and punctual attendance.
  • Have simple machinist skills, at a minimum.
  • Experience with the use of hand and power tools, electric meters and material handling equipment in performing duties.
  • Experience with the installation, maintenance and repair of equipment/machines with computer interfaces.
  • Adaptable to a fast-paced environment, with the ability to handle multiple assigned tasks and priorities.
  • Strong problem solving skills, detail oriented and thorough.
  • Strong data-based decision making skills, with the ability to plan and prioritize assigned tasks according to company goals and objectives.
  • Ability to effectively communicate and interact with all levels of management/personnel, be a team player and be able to build rapport/credibility.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ook) is required. Knowledge of CMMS software applications is a plus.

Education and/or Experience:

  • Minimum of High School Diploma or GED. Apprenticeship, completion of a technical school program, Associates degree or technical certificate in maintenance is a plus.
  • 4+ years of related experience and/or training, or the equivalent combination of education, training and experience, is preferred.
  • 4+ years technical experience in the electronics, medical device, automotive or aerospace manufacturing industries is a plus.
